Run an XT60 battery in a Deans rifle

This compact adapter lets you use an XT60-connected battery in a rifle wired for Deans (T-plug). The female Deans end connects to your rifle wiring while the male XT60 end takes your battery.

Compact inline unit

The short, pre-wired unit keeps the connection tidy and adds minimal length inside the stock or handguard, so it fits easily alongside your battery.

Fitting

No soldering is required. Plug the adapter inline between battery and rifle, tuck the wiring away neatly, and you are ready to go.

Check polarity first

Always confirm that polarity is correct before connecting the battery to avoid damage to your wiring or gearbox. Explore more batteries, BBs and gas.

Standardise your connectors

Many players move their whole collection to one connector type over time, and this adapter is a quick, low-cost way to keep an XT60 battery in service on Deans-wired guns until you get round to it.

Frequently asked questions

What does this adapter do?

It lets you use an XT60-connected battery in a rifle wired for Deans (T-plug). The female Deans end connects to your rifle and the male XT60 end takes your battery.

Do I need to solder it?

No. It is pre-wired, so you just plug it inline between your battery and rifle, tuck the wiring away and you are ready to go.

Will it fit inside my stock?

It is a compact inline unit that adds minimal length, so it fits easily alongside your battery in most stocks and handguards.

Why check polarity?

Always confirm polarity is correct before connecting the battery. A reversed connection can damage your wiring or gearbox, so double-check red and black before use.

Does the adapter reduce performance?

Any adapter adds a little resistance. On stock and lightly upgraded guns this is minor, but very high-drain builds are best standardised on one connector.
